County approves $60,000 reallocation to support regional airline subsidy
Summary
The Board agreed to reallocate $60,000 of a previously committed $220,000 capital match to cover Golden Triangle Regional Airport's 20% share of a $300,000 Minimum Revenue Guarantee regional subsidy for SkyWest/American service; the change requires no new cash layout and leaves $160,000 in net savings for the county.

Matt Dowell, Executive Director of the Golden Triangle Regional Airport, asked the Board to reallocate $60,000 of a previously committed $220,000 county capital match to cover GTRA's 20% proportionate share of a $300,000 temporary Minimum Revenue Guarantee regional subsidy to support SkyWest/American service. Dowell said a subsequent direct state allocation eliminated the county's land loan debt obligation, leaving the county able to reassign part of the previously committed capital.
On a motion by Supervisor Pattie Little, seconded by Supervisor Joe Williams, the Board adopted Resolution No. RS-20260622- approving the 20% proportionate share commitment of $60,000 and authorized the Board President to execute all necessary documents. County officials noted the reallocation requires no new cash layout and leaves the county with $160,000 in net savings from the originally committed $220,000.
